Beispiel #1
0
function setCikkDokumentumok()
{
    global $Aktoldal, $MySqliLink;
    $ErrorStr = '';
    $Oid = 0;
    $Cid = $_SESSION['SzerkCikk' . 'id'];
    $SelectStr = "SELECT Oid From OldalCikkei WHERE Cid='{$Cid}'";
    $result = mysqli_query($MySqliLink, $SelectStr) or die("Hiba sCK 02");
    $rowDB = mysqli_num_rows($result);
    if ($rowDB > 0) {
        $row = mysqli_fetch_array($result);
        mysqli_free_result($result);
        $Oid = $row['Oid'];
        if ($_SESSION['AktFelhasznalo' . 'FSzint'] > 2 && isset($_POST['submitCikkDokForm'])) {
            if (isset($_POST["rowDB"])) {
                $rowDB = test_post($_POST["rowDB"]);
            }
            $DNev = '';
            //=============================HIBAKEZELÉS==============================
            /*     for($i=0; $i<$rowDB; $i++) {
                       if (isset($_POST["CDNev_$i"])) {
                           $DNev=test_post($_POST["CDNev_$i"]); echo "<h1>$i DNev: $DNev</h1>";
                           if(strlen($DNev)>40) {                         
                               $ErrorStr .= "ErrH01 $DNev <br>\n";
                               $DNev=substr($DNev,0,40);                        
                           }
                       }
                   }*/
            //====================POST beillesztése adatbázisba=====================
            if ($Oid == $Aktoldal['id']) {
                for ($i = 0; $i < $rowDB; $i++) {
                    if (isset($_POST["CDFile_{$i}"]) && $_POST["CDFile_{$i}"] != '') {
                        $DFile = FileNevTisztit($_POST["CDFile_{$i}"]);
                        $DLeiras = '';
                        $DMeretKB = 0;
                        $DSorszam = 0;
                        if (isset($_POST["CDLeiras_{$i}"])) {
                            $DLeiras = test_post($_POST["CDLeiras_{$i}"]);
                        }
                        if (isset($_POST["CDMeretKB_{$i}"])) {
                            $DMeretKB = test_post($_POST["CDMeretKB_{$i}"]);
                        }
                        if (isset($_POST["CDSorszam_{$i}"])) {
                            $DSorszam = test_post($_POST["CDSorszam_{$i}"]);
                        }
                        if (isset($_POST["CDNev_{$i}"])) {
                            $DNev = test_post($_POST["CDNev_{$i}"]);
                        }
                        // echo "<h1>$i DNev: $DNev</h1>";
                        if (strlen($DNev) > 40) {
                            $ErrorStr .= "ErrH01 {$DNev} <br>\n";
                            $DNev = substr($DNev, 0, 40);
                        }
                    }
                    $UpdateStr = "UPDATE CikkDokumentumok SET \n                                DNev='{$DNev}', \n                                DLeiras='{$DLeiras}', \n                                DMeretKB='{$DMeretKB}', \n                                DSorszam='{$DSorszam}' \n                                WHERE DFile='{$DFile}' \n                                AND Cid={$Cid}";
                    mysqli_query($MySqliLink, $UpdateStr) or die("Hiba uCK 01");
                    setCikkDokTorol($i);
                }
            }
        }
    }
    return $ErrorStr;
}
Beispiel #2
0
function setCikkKepek()
{
    global $Aktoldal, $MySqliLink;
    $ErrorStr = '';
    $Oid = 0;
    $Cid = $_SESSION['SzerkCikk' . 'id'];
    $SelectStr = "SELECT Oid From OldalCikkei WHERE Cid='{$Cid}'";
    $result = mysqli_query($MySqliLink, $SelectStr) or die("Hiba sCK 02");
    $rowDB = mysqli_num_rows($result);
    if ($rowDB > 0) {
        $row = mysqli_fetch_array($result);
        mysqli_free_result($result);
        $Oid = $row['Oid'];
        if ($_SESSION['AktFelhasznalo' . 'FSzint'] > 2 && isset($_POST['submitCikkKepForm'])) {
            if (isset($_POST["rowDB"])) {
                $rowDB = test_post($_POST["rowDB"]);
            }
            $KNev = '';
            //=============================HIBAKEZELÉS==============================
            /*      for($i=0; $i<$rowDB; $i++) {
                        if (isset($_POST["CKNev_$i"])) {
                            $KNev=test_post($_POST["CKNev_$i"]);
                            if(strlen($KNev)>40) {                         
                                $ErrorStr .= "ErrH01 $KNev <br>\n";
                                $KNev=substr($KNev,0,40);                        
                            }
                        }
                    }*/
            //====================POST beillesztése adatbázisba=====================
            if ($Oid == $Aktoldal['id']) {
                for ($i = 0; $i < $rowDB; $i++) {
                    if (isset($_POST["CKFile_{$i}"]) && $_POST["CKFile_{$i}"] != '') {
                        $KFile = FileNevTisztit($_POST["CKFile_{$i}"]);
                        $KLeiras = '';
                        $KSzelesseg = 0;
                        $KMagassag = 0;
                        $KStilus = 0;
                        $KSorszam = 0;
                        if (isset($_POST["CKLeiras_{$i}"])) {
                            $KLeiras = test_post($_POST["CKLeiras_{$i}"]);
                        }
                        if (isset($_POST["CKSzelesseg_{$i}"])) {
                            $KSzelesseg = test_post($_POST["CKSzelesseg_{$i}"]);
                        }
                        if (isset($_POST["CKMagassag_{$i}"])) {
                            $KMagassag = test_post($_POST["CKMagassag_{$i}"]);
                        }
                        if (isset($_POST["CKStilus_{$i}"])) {
                            $KStilus = test_post($_POST["CKStilus_{$i}"]);
                        }
                        if (isset($_POST["CKSorszam_{$i}"])) {
                            $KSorszam = test_post($_POST["CKSorszam_{$i}"]);
                        }
                        if (isset($_POST["CKNev_{$i}"])) {
                            $KNev = test_post($_POST["CKNev_{$i}"]);
                            if (strlen($KNev) > 40) {
                                $ErrorStr .= "ErrH01 {$KNev} <br>\n";
                                $KNev = substr($KNev, 0, 40);
                            }
                        }
                    }
                    $UpdateStr = "UPDATE CikkKepek SET \n                                KNev='{$KNev}', \n                                KLeiras='{$KLeiras}', \n                                KSzelesseg='{$KSzelesseg}', \n                                KMagassag='{$KMagassag}', \n                                KStilus='{$KStilus}', \n                                KSorszam='{$KSorszam}' \n                                WHERE KFile='{$KFile}' \n                                AND Cid={$Cid}";
                    mysqli_query($MySqliLink, $UpdateStr) or die("Hiba uCK 01");
                    setCikkKepTorol($i);
                }
            }
        }
    }
    return $ErrorStr;
}